When you sell an option, you earn an immediate premium, and you get to keep that premium irrespective of the … how many miles can you walk in 24 hoursWebMar 28, 2015 · The loss is restricted to Rs.6.35/- as long as the spot price is trading at any price below the strike of 2050. From 2050 to 2056.35 (breakeven price) we can see the losses getting minimized. At 2056.35 we can see that there is neither a profit nor a loss. Above 2056.35 the call option starts making money. how many miles can you put on a toyota rav 4WebThe option premium is A) the market price of the option.
